Pantene goes natural with Nature Fusion
11 February 2009 | By Popsop Team
Procter & Gamble has recenty launched a new Pantene hair care collection called Nature Fusion, and a campaign that touts the collection’s naturally derived nourishing properties.
Nature Fusion, which hits shelves this month, taps into the natural trend while leveraging the brand’s scientific claims. Ads breaking this week highlight the brand’s promise of delivering “softer, shinier and stronger hair.”
One TV spot, via Grey, New York, opens with a former model Padma Lakshmi asking the question: “Think only a salon brand can unlock nature’s power? Well I’ve discovered something new.” The ad then shows a cassia flower engulfed in a honey-golden capsule, representing Pantene merging with nature.
“We think that consumers who enjoy natural ingredients also deserve high quality performance, so we’re thrilled to be able to offer women a hair care collection that actually does what it promises,” Craig Bahner, vp and general manager of P&G North American hair care, said in a statement.
Nature Fusion comes in two varieties: Moisture Balance shampoos and conditioners that are made with ingredients such as cassia, ginger and aloe vera extracts; and Smooth Vitality, which includes bamboo and grapeseed extracts. Both retail for $3.99. A leave-in Fusion Smoothing Creme is also part of the collection and sells for $5.99.
